Preliminary validation of the Virtual Kitchen Challenge as an objective and sensitive measure of everyday function associated with cerebrovascular disease.

Sophia L HolmqvistKatie JobsonDennis DesalmeStephanie M SimoneMolly TassoniMoira McKniffTakehiko YamaguchiIngrid OlsonNadine MartinTania Giovannetti
Published in: Alzheimer's & dementia (Amsterdam, Netherlands) (2024)
Virtual Kitchen Challenge (VKC) scores showed significant improvement from training to test conditions.VKC scores (completion time and proportion of time off screen) were associated with a neuroimaging biomarker of brain health (white matter hyperintensities).
